                        I was in that heat with Taylor, and he has designed/built a terrific rigger and he still has room for more tweaking. When he gets a few more items dialed in (and some better driving!), watch out.

                        The one thing I always like to see in a rigger (and rarely do) is the amount of room there is to be able to work on them. Motor installation, cell and ESC placement, where to put all the battery wires, etc, etc. He's done a great job! As for how well it runs? Well, just watch the video.

                        Great job, Taylor. I hope your rigger kit helps bring back rigger racing. It's a kick in the pants.

                              Guys... The specifications listed on OSE.com under "Electric Boat Hulls" clearly list some recommended setups... amongst which are both 2S and 4S setups:


                              Some recommended motors and battery power.
                              Neu 1512 1D with 2s2p
                              Neu 1515 1D with 2s2p
                              Feigao 6XL with 2s2p

                              Feigao 7XL, 8XL or 9XL with 4s1p
                              Neu 1515 1Y with 4s1p
                              AquaCraft combo with 12 NiMH or 4s1p
                              Based on the specifications and recommended setups that Taylor has described here, I would also assume you could fit 6-cells in it as well... Just have to pick the right motor...
